Buscar
Estás en modo de exploración. debe iniciar sesión para usar MEMORY

   Inicia sesión para empezar

level: Föreläsning 3

Questions and Answers List

level questions: Föreläsning 3

QuestionAnswer
Hur bestämmer man antal bits på en CPU?Det kan man se på antalet trådar som finns på komponenten.
Vad är en buss? (bus på engelska)Kollektion utav trådar som kopplar ihop Main-memory med CPUn.
Hur läser CPUn data ifrån Main-memory?CPU:n gör detta genom att tillhandahålla adressen till den relevanta minnescellen tillsammans med en elektronisk signal som berättar minneskretsen som den är tänkt att hämta data i den angivna cellen.
Hur skriver CPUn data Main-memory?CPU:n gör detta genom att tillhandahålla adress för destinationscellen och data som ska lagras tillsammans med lämplig elektronisk signal som talar om för huvudminnet att det är tänkt att lagra data skickas till den
Vad är Cache Memory?Denna typ av minne är en del (kanske flera hundra kB) av höghastighets minne som finns i själva processorn. I detta speciella minnesområde försöker maskinen behålla en kopia av den del av huvudminnet som är av aktuellt intresse.
Vad betyder flops?Flyttalsoperationer per Sekund
Vad är en Maskininstruktion?En massa ettor och nollor. Binärttal
Vad betyder Maskinspråk?Det är alla instruktioner datorn har. Alltså alla 1or och 0or.
Vad betyder RISC? (Reduced Instruction Set Computing)Det är en typ utav proccessornarkitektur vissa processor tillhandahåller. Denna typ får processorn några få instruktioner. Vilket är simpelt och enkelt.
Vad är CISC? (Complex Instruction Set Computing)Det är en typ utav proccessornarkitektur vissa processor tillhandahåller. Denna typ får processorn många instruktioner. Vilket är ganska smidigt men tar längre tid. Intel använder sig utav denna
Vad händer med datorn när man överklockar processorn?Dels blir CPUn varmare och det finns en risk att datorn stängs av om de segare delarna utav processorn inte hinner med de snabba.
Vad är OP-Code?Den specifierar vilken kod som ska exekveras.
Vad betyder Operand?Ger en mer detajlerad information om OP-koden.
Vad betyder fetch? (i fetch decode execute cykeln)Det är när processorn hämtar information ifrån minnet och lägger det i registret. Sedan ökar programräknaren med två för att kunna göra nästa instruktion.
Vad betyder decode? (i fetch decode execute cykeln)Efter att datan har skickats till registret så skickas datat till controlunit. Den kan sedan översätta bitsträngen, de 4 första siffrorna = OP-code(utförandet) och sista 4 är operand (detajerade informationen)
Vad betyder Execute? (i fetch decode execute cykeln)Operanden blir kopierad till MAR eftersom den har addressen till kdoen och OP-code till MDR. Eftersom MDR har nu bara bit med ingen address så skickas den till Accumulatorn (ACC).
Vad är programcounter?Programcountern räknar efter varje fetchning som tas upp av datorn. Den befinner sig i CPUn:s register.
Vad är ALU?Den är en del i CPU:n i en dator som utför logiska operationer som AND och OR samt enklare aritmetiska operationer såsom addition och subtraktion.
Förklara simpelt hur Rotate and shift fungerarTvå binära tal eller fler, där du sätter in ena biten i ena talets vänstra binära tal sätts in i den andra binära talet fast längs till höger och alla bitar shiftar åt höger.
Vad gör en controller?Elektriskenhet, översätter hur en spu snackar och vad den är uppkopplad till. Med hjälp utav mjukvara. (Drivers)
Vad är en Port?Kan vara fysisk och teoretisk plats där komponenter är anslutna.
Vad är Cache?Cacheminnet mellan lagrar data. Detta underlättar för minnet.
Vad är DMA? (Direct Memory Access)Det är när en controller har tillgång till minnet.
Vad var Von Neumann Bottleneck?En viss dataarkitektur där alla komponenter har tillgång till cpun på samma buss, men bara en i taget. Så hastigheten är låg eftersom den är innefektiv.
Vad är Handshaking?Utrycket är en viss metod för att synkronisera enheters dataöverföring med mikroprocessorer. Mikroprocessorn går i samma hastighet som den andra enheten har för att synkronisera dataöverföring.
Vad är Parallell kommunikation?Det är när en enhet har flertal kommunikations vägar och skickar flera bits samtidigt, har begränsningar eftersom många vägar kan orsaka störningar.
Vad är Seriell Kommunikation?Det är när en enhet skickar data genom en enstaka kommunikations väg och skickar då en bit i taget. Oftast lättare teknik och snabbare än Parallell kommunikation.
Hur många Bits per sekund är en Kbps?1000 bits.
Hur många Bits per sekund är en Mbps?1 miljon bits.
Hur många Bits per sekund är en Gbps?1 Miljard bits.
Vad är bandwidth? (bandbredd)Den maximala tillgängliga antalet utav bits per sekund i en kabel.
Vilken Gate är det här? (Vilken standard är det)XNOR, Usa standard.
Vilken Gate är det här? (Vilken standard är det)AND, USA standard.
Vilken Gate är det här? (Vilken standard är det)OR, Amerikans
Vilken Gate är det här? (Vilken standard är det)NAND, USA standard.
Vilken Gate är det här? (Vilken standard är det)NOR, USA standard
Vilken Gate är det här? (Vilken standard är det)NOT, USA standard
Vilken Gate är det här? (Vilken standard är det)XOR, Usa standard